A collaborative effort exploring the use of scientific method for color imaging and process control. Test Targets 4.0 is the result of student teamwork to publish a technical journal for a graduate-level course titled Advanced Color Management. Offered by the School of Print Media (SPM) at Rochester Institute of Technology (RIT), the course is “a platform to experiment and to realize a new digital imaging paradigm and the dynamics of teamwork” (Robert Chung, Gravure Research Professor). Published by RIT School of Print Media, Rochester, NY, March 2003.
